Title: Bypass Air Tank to Move 4905
Post by: FloridaCliff on April 05, 2024, 08:43:01 AM
Need to move 4905 with no motor.  Found a leak in front tank and need a work around. Could I plumb air straight to the input side of park brake by driver just to release brakes? 
Title: Re: Bypass Air Tank to Move 4905
Post by: Van on April 05, 2024, 11:07:16 AM
Plug your lines in the rear, air some shop air or portable air compressor then move. ;)
Title: Re: Bypass Air Tank to Move 4905
Post by: FloridaCliff on April 06, 2024, 01:59:30 AM
Van, yeah, thats how I would do it but there is a leak in the front air tank.  I ended up feeding the supply directly into the output of the park release.
